Gates Farm Covered Bridge
Bridge
Photo: Srbergeron,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Gates Farm Covered Bridge is a covered bridge that crosses the Seymour River off State Route 15 in Cambridge, Vermont. Built in 1897, it is last bridge to be built during the historic period of covered bridge construction with the Burr arch design. Cambridge
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
Cambridge is a town in Lamoille County, Vermont, United States. The population was 3,839 at the 2020 United States Census. Cambridge includes the villages of Jeffersonville and Cambridge. Cambridge is situated 2½ miles west of Cambridge Rescue Squad.
